In this episode of Ornamentations, Katie Strachan shares a mix of stitching updates, finishes, and a special guest appearance from her mother. She begins by showing a finished section of Ann Harper by Fox & Rabbit, stitched on 48-count Legacy Linen in Marchpane, and discusses her ongoing work on the 38-count version of Paisley by Stacy Nash Designs, noting the fabric and thread choices. She also reviews her 12x12 ornament challenge progress, highlighting finishes from previous months, including a Prairie Schooler piece, an Animal Cracker ornament, and a Stacy Nash gingerbread house design.

Ann Harper 1838 by Fox & Rabbit is stitched on Legacy Linen 48 count Marchpane with:
Surfine 2079, 2152, 2199, 2307, 2664, 2674
NB: remove the 2 in front and you have the 100/3 color number

Paisley (38 count version) is stitched on Legacy Linen 38 count Fuller's Teazel with 
100/3 232, 264
Gobelins 671, 718, 945, F02, Creme
Note that F02 and Creme are both off whites - you don't need both, you can pick whichever your prefer/whatever best suits your linen. Creme is lighter and brighter than F02.
